As you navigate the eerie hallways of the Rhodes Hill Care Center in Resident Evil Requiem, you may stumble upon peculiar warped closets. These enigmatic structures can be interacted with by Grace, although she lacks the physical prowess and necessary tools to open them fully.
If you’re seeking a key or a crowbar to help Grace pry these closets open, you can save yourself the trouble.
Is Grace Able to Open Warped Closets?
In short, the answer is no. Grace is unable to open the warped closets when she first encounters them. It’s crucial to simply leave them untouched, as this design choice underscores the contrasting mechanics and abilities between Grace and Leon throughout the game.
Can Leon Access Warped Closets?

In contrast, warped closets are specifically designed for Leon to access. Unlike Grace, he wields a hatchet that allows him to pry these closets open with ease and retrieve the valuable items hidden inside.
- If you’re anxious about potentially overlooking a vital story item, rest easy. Warped closets are not essential for advancing through the main narrative.
- However, for those striving for 100% completion, these closets become crucial. One particular warped closet within the Care Center conceals a Raccoon memoriam puppet, one of 25 required for completion. Destroying this puppet will unlock the Advanced Tuning option, enhancing your weapon parts tuning capabilities.
